Join the blue and gold carriages of the Venice-Simplon-Orient-Express in the beautiful city of Venice and spend overnight on board. The next day, enjoy the passing scenery as the train travels through Austria into the Czech Republic, arriving in Prague in the afternoon. Spend two nights in this fascinating city. On rejoining the train continue your journey through the Czech Republic and into Germany. Arrive the following morning at your destination, Paris.

Wednesday - Board the splendid Wagons-Lits carriages of the Venice Simplon-Orient-Express at Venice Santa Lucia station. Throughout your journey you will be attended by your own personal steward. After you have settled into your comfortable compartment it will soon be time to dress for dinner. Why not sip an aperitif in the Bar Car, listening to the sounds of the baby grand piano before taking your seat in one of the beautifully restored restaurant cars. After dinner you may want to linger in the bar and when you are ready you can retire to your compartment which has now been transformed into a cosy bedroom.
Thursday - Breakfast is served in your compartment at a time to suit you. Spend the morning relaxing in the comfort of your compartment, gazing at the beautiful passing scenery as the train heads towards Prague, or chatting with fellow travellers over coffee in the Bar Car. Later, enjoy a three-course lunch in one of the other magnificent restaurant cars. The train pulls in to Prague’s Smichov station in the afternoon.
Transfer to your chosen hotel for two nights. (Accommodation and transfers not included).
Friday - Enjoy the many attractions of one of the most beautiful cities in Europe. The medieval streets of the Old Town and the Hradcany Castle are in pleasing contrast to the twentieth century buildings of Wenceslas Square. Take a guided tour or wander at your pleasure, stopping at one of the many pavement cafés for coffee.
Saturday - The morning is at your leisure before being welcomed aboard the Venice Simplon-Orient-Express. Your private compartment awaits. Afternoon tea is served by your personal steward as you relax on board. A leisurely four-course dinner is served, prepared on board by our skilled French chefs. Enjoy a brandy or liqueur with convivial company in the Bar before retiring for the night.
Sunday - Enjoy breakfast in the comforts of your cabin before your morning arrival in Paris.
